Abstract

The utility model discloses a LED display screen, include: a box body; the connecting seat is fixedly arranged on the box body; the LED module is arranged on the connecting seat through the magnetic attraction structure; the first sealing element is arranged between the box body and the connecting seat; and the second sealing element is arranged between the connecting seat and the LED module. Through the structure, the LED module can be prevented from being installed or detached by adopting the dismounting tool which needs to penetrate through the pixel points of the LED module, so that the space for the dismounting tool to penetrate through is not required to be reserved between the pixel points of the LED module, the distance between the pixel points of the LED module is favorably reduced, and the requirement of a user is met.

Description

LED display screen
Technical Field
The utility model relates to a display screen technical field, in particular to LED display screen.
Background
Among the prior art, the LED display screen includes the LED module usually and has integrateed electrical component's box, wherein, be used for open air front maintenance LED display screen to adopt screw or card bolt to fix the LED module on the box generally, and consider that need adopt assembly and disassembly tools to install or dismantle the LED module, consequently need reserve the space that supplies assembly and disassembly tools to pass between the pixel of LED module, lead to the distance between the pixel great, can't satisfy user's demand.

Referring to fig. 1 and 4, the LED display screen according to the embodiment of the present invention includes a box (not shown in the figure), a connecting seat 100, an LED module, a first sealing member and a second sealing member.
Connecting seat 100 is fixed to be set up on the box, and is concrete, and connecting seat 100 passes through the fix with screw on the box, is provided with the magnetic structure between LED module and the connecting seat 100, and the LED module passes through the magnetic structure and sets up on connecting seat 100, and first sealing member sets up between box and connecting seat 100, and the second sealing member sets up between connecting seat 100 and the LED module.
Through the structure, the LED module can be prevented from being installed or detached by adopting the dismounting tool which needs to pass through the pixel points of the LED module, so that the space for the dismounting tool to pass through is not required to be reserved between the pixel points of the LED module, the distance between the pixel points of the LED module is favorably reduced, and the requirement of a user is met.
Referring to fig. 1 and 4, in some embodiments, the LED module includes a cover 200, a bottom case 300, and a circuit board 400 integrated with LED beads, the bottom case 300 is disposed on one side of the circuit board 400, and the cover 200 is disposed on the other side of the circuit board 400, where a specific structure of the LED module is a known technology in the art and is not described herein.
Referring to fig. 1, 2, 4 and 5, in some embodiments, the magnetic attraction structure includes a first magnetic attraction member 310 disposed on the bottom housing 300 and a second magnetic attraction member 110 disposed on the connection seat 100.
In some embodiments, the first magnetic attraction member 310 is configured as a magnet, and the second magnetic attraction member 110 is configured as a metal member capable of being attracted by the magnet, which is simple in structure and easy to implement.
It should be noted that, in some embodiments, the second magnetic attraction member is configured as a magnet, and the first magnetic attraction member is configured as a metal member capable of being attracted by the magnet, but both the first magnetic attraction member and the second magnetic attraction member may also be configured as magnets, and are not limited herein.
Referring to fig. 1 and 4, in some embodiments, the second sealing member is a first elastic sealing ring 500, and the first elastic sealing ring 500 is interposed between the bottom case 300 and the connection seat 100, which is simple in structure and easy to implement.
Referring to fig. 2 and 7, in some embodiments, a mounting groove 120 for limiting is provided on the connection seat 100 corresponding to the first elastic sealing ring 500, and the first elastic sealing ring 500 is disposed in the mounting groove 120 to limit the first elastic sealing ring 500, which is beneficial to ensuring the stability of the first elastic sealing ring 500 in the working process.
Referring to fig. 3, 5 and 7, in some embodiments, a side of the bottom shell 300 facing the connection seat 100 is provided with at least one annular flange 320 capable of abutting against the first elastic sealing ring 500, and a side of the first elastic sealing ring 500 facing the bottom shell 300 is provided with a plugging groove 510 for plugging the annular flange 320, which is beneficial to improve the sealing effect. Specifically, two annular flanges 320 are provided, but the number of the annular flanges 320 may also be one or other numbers, and is not limited herein.
It should be noted that, in some embodiments, the second sealing element may also be a sealing glue disposed between the bottom shell and the connection seat, which is not limited herein.
Referring to fig. 6 and 7, in some embodiments, the circumferential side of the bottom chassis 300 is provided with a water chute 330, and the water chute 330 can drain water accumulated at the top of the bottom chassis 300.
It should be noted that in some embodiments, the first sealing element is a second elastic sealing ring (not shown in the figures), and the second elastic sealing ring is sandwiched between the box body and the connecting seat 100, and the structure is simple and easy to implement.
It should be noted that, in some embodiments, the first sealing element may also be a sealing glue disposed between the box body and the connection seat, which is not limited herein.
In some embodiments, a positioning structure is disposed between the connecting seat 100 and the bottom case 300, so as to limit a relative position relationship between the connecting seat 100 and the bottom case 300, which is beneficial to improving the stability of the LED display screen.
Referring to fig. 2 and 5, in some embodiments, the positioning structure includes a positioning pin 340 and a positioning hole 130, one of the positioning pin 340 and the positioning hole 130 is disposed on the bottom housing 300, and the other is disposed on the connecting base 100, which is simple in structure and facilitates alignment between the bottom housing 300 and the connecting base 100 during assembly.
It should be noted that, in some embodiments, the positioning structure may also be a clamping structure disposed between the bottom shell and the connection seat, which is not limited herein.
Referring to fig. 7, in some embodiments, a diversion slope 350 is provided on the bottom chassis 300 corresponding to the water chute 330, and the diversion slope 350 is used for diverting water accumulated on the top of the bottom chassis 300 into the water chute 330, so that the water accumulated on the top of the bottom chassis 300 can be drained through the water chute 330 in time.
